Well.. red/brown lemonades are both popular in Ireland. The red lemonade, brown lemonade and white lemonades they all are "lemon flavored" with a little added variety.
The big difference between all of these is the coloring.
I honestly dont taste a huge difference between them all but red lemonade always reminds me of cherry 7-up because of its color (:

from what i know about pink lemonade its just the food coloring, but ya never know what people will come up with ...
